Laura Marie Greenwood (1897–1951) was an American painter of portraits and still lifes. She worked with oils, watercolors and pastels. She worked with oils, watercolors and pastels. Greenwood also lectured on art history and taught fine art.
Kidnap and Ransom is a British television three-part miniseries, originally shown on ITV in January 2011 with a second series following in February 2012. The series follows the work of a British hostage negotiator Dominic King, played by Trevor Eve, who is also executive producer of the series.
